linux-stable/drivers/usb/dwc3
Thinh Nguyen 30892cba55 usb: dwc3: gadget: Set IOC if not enough for extra TRBs
If we run out of TRBs because we need extra TRBs, make sure to set the
IOC bit for the previously prepared TRB to get completion notification
to free up TRBs to resume later.

Signed-off-by: Thinh Nguyen <Thinh.Nguyen@synopsys.com>
Signed-off-by: Felipe Balbi <balbi@kernel.org>
2020-10-02 09:57:44 +03:00
..
core.c usb: dwc3: core: add phy cleanup for probe error handling 2020-10-02 09:57:42 +03:00
core.h usb: dwc3: allocate gadget structure dynamically 2020-10-02 09:57:42 +03:00
debug.h usb: dwc3: debug: fix checkpatch warning 2020-10-02 09:43:35 +03:00
debugfs.c usb: dwc3: debugfs: do not queue work if try to change mode on non-drd 2020-10-02 09:57:42 +03:00
drd.c usb: dwc3: Replace HTTP links with HTTPS ones 2020-07-15 16:33:51 +02:00
dwc3-exynos.c Revert "usb: dwc3: exynos: Add support for Exynos5422 suspend clk" 2020-06-24 09:52:23 +03:00
dwc3-haps.c usb: dwc3: dwc3-haps: Function headers are not suitable for kerneldoc 2020-07-03 10:18:40 +02:00
dwc3-keystone.c usb: dwc3: Replace HTTP links with HTTPS ones 2020-07-15 16:33:51 +02:00
dwc3-meson-g12a.c usb: dwc-meson-g12a: Add support for USB on AXG SoCs 2020-10-02 09:57:39 +03:00
dwc3-of-simple.c usb: dwc3: simple: add support for Hikey 970 2020-09-24 11:56:01 +03:00
dwc3-omap.c usb: dwc3: Replace HTTP links with HTTPS ones 2020-07-15 16:33:51 +02:00
dwc3-pci.c usb: dwc3: pci: Allow Elkhart Lake to utilize DSM method for PM functionality 2020-10-02 09:57:40 +03:00
dwc3-qcom.c usb: dwc3: qcom: fix checkpatch warnings 2020-10-02 09:43:35 +03:00
dwc3-st.c usb: dwc3: convert to devm_platform_ioremap_resource_byname 2020-07-29 16:49:37 +02:00
ep0.c usb: dwc3: ep0: Fix ZLP for OUT ep0 requests 2020-10-02 09:57:44 +03:00
gadget.c usb: dwc3: gadget: Set IOC if not enough for extra TRBs 2020-10-02 09:57:44 +03:00
gadget.h usb: dwc3: allocate gadget structure dynamically 2020-10-02 09:57:42 +03:00
host.c usb: dwc3: Replace HTTP links with HTTPS ones 2020-07-15 16:33:51 +02:00
io.h usb: dwc3: Replace HTTP links with HTTPS ones 2020-07-15 16:33:51 +02:00
Kconfig usb: dwc3: select USB_ROLE_SWITCH 2020-05-09 11:05:09 +03:00
Makefile usb: dwc3: Add Amlogic G12A DWC3 glue 2019-05-03 09:13:47 +03:00
trace.c usb: dwc3: Replace HTTP links with HTTPS ones 2020-07-15 16:33:51 +02:00
trace.h usb: dwc3: trace: fix checkpatch warnings 2020-10-02 09:43:35 +03:00
ulpi.c usb: dwc3: ulpi: fix checkpatch warning 2020-10-02 09:43:35 +03:00